The United States Virgin Islands have a unique and challenging constitutional status as an unincorporated territory acquired from Denmark in 1917. While the territory has a self-sufficient governmental structure similar to a US state, it lacks its own constitution and is not fully protected by the US Constitution due to rulings in the Insular Cases.
